*Manon Lescaut*, Giacomo Puccini's opera from 1893, is currently newsworthy due to its return to the Liceu. The opera, Puccini's first major operatic success, is based on the same story as Massenet's opera of the same name, but Puccini famously argued that Manon could have more than one lover, leading to a bolder, more Wagnerian interpretation. The current production at the Liceu is generating both enthusiasm and discord, suggesting differing opinions on its staging or interpretation. The opera's return highlights the enduring appeal and continued relevance of Puccini's work, while also sparking debate about its artistic merit and how it is presented to modern audiences.
